Abstract
A control system may include a processor that may receive a first dataset associated with a type of load device coupled to a relay device. The processor may then receive a second dataset associated with one or more operations of the load device over a period of time. The processor may also determine a switching profile to control moving an armature of the relay device between a first position and a second position based on the first dataset and the second dataset, such that the switching profile comprises a firing angle for moving the armature with respect to an electrical waveform. The processor may then control a current provided to a relay coil of the relay device based on the switching profile.
